That would be awesome if you're right! It could also be coincidental,
though. Also, perhaps it's just me but I simply cannot imagine location data
helping to deliver results in a concrete way. I suppose your requests could
be routed through nearby servers, reducing latency a bit, but I really can't
imagine that this is what is happening. The developers haven't replied to
any queries about this, and I imagine if it really did help the recognition
results, that they could use that as a huge selling point for the app.

I decided to experiment with TapTapSee location  services if they are 


really necessary. I took a T-shirt that had something written on it. 


At first,  I used the  a without location services on. It only told me 


that it was red and blue. Wen I turned on location services on, it 


told me what was on the shirt. It said, "Mind,the Gap." With location 


services on, I got more accurate results. ,i decided to keep location 


services turned on. I hope this helps others decide what option they will


choose.
